Boyle's law states that the pressure of a gas is inversely proportional to its volume, at constant temperature. Therefore, a graph of Boyle's law would show pressure on the y-axis and volume on the x-axis, with a downward-sloping curve as volume decreases, pressure increases, and vice versa. The curve is hyperbolic, approaching but never reaching zero pressure as volume approaches infinity.
